In The Name of Allah, the Beneficent, the Merciful
1. Alif Lam Mim.
2. Allah, (there is) no god but He, the Everliving, the Self-subsisting
by Whom all things subsist
3. He has revealed to you the Book with truth, verifying that which
is before it, and He revealed the Tavrat and the Injeel aforetime, a guidance
for the people, and He sent the Furqan.
4. Surely they who disbelieve in the communications of Allah they shall
have a severe chastisement; and Allah is Mighty, the Lord of retribution.
5. Allahsurely nothing is hidden from Him in the earth or in the heaven.
6. He it is Who shapes you in the wombs as He likes; there is no god
but He, the Mighty, the Wise
7. He it is Who has revealed the Book to you; some of its verses are
decisive, they are the basis of the Book, and others are allegorical; then
as for those in whose hearts there is perversity they follow the part of
it which is allegorical, seeking to mislead and seeking to give it (their
own) interpretation. but none knows its interpretation except Allah, and
those who are firmly rooted in knowledge say: We believe in it, it is all
from our Lord; and none do mind except those having understanding.
8. Our Lord! make not our hearts to deviate after Thou hast guided
us aright, and grant us from Thee mercy; surely Thou art the most liberal
Giver.
9. Our Lord! surely Thou art the Gatherer of men on a day about which
there is no doubt; surely Allah will not fail (His) promise.
10. (As for) those who disbelieve, surely neither their wealth nor
their children shall avail them in the least against Allah, and these it
is who are the fuel of the fire.
11. Like the striving of the people of Firon and those before them;
they rejected Our communications, so Allah destroyed them on account of
their faults; and Allah is severe in requiting (evil).
12: Say to those who disbelieve: You shall be vanquished, and driven
together to hell; and evil is the resting-place.
13. Indeed there was a sign for you in the two hosts (which) met together
in encounter; one party fighting in the way of Allah and the other unbelieving,
whom they saw twice as.many as themselves with the sight of the eye and
Allah strengthens with His aid whom He pleases; most surely there is a
lesson in this for those who have sight.
14. The love of desires, of women and sons and hoarded treasures of
gold and silver and well bred horses and cattle and tilth, is made to seem
fair to men; this is the provision of the life of this world; and Allah
is He with Whom is the good goal (of life).
15. Say:Shall}I tell you what is better than these? For those who guard
(against evil) are gardens with their Lord, beneath which rivers flow,
to abide in them, and pure mates and Allahs pleasure; and Allah sees the
servants.
16. Those who say: Our Lord! surely we believe, therefore forgive us
our faults and save us from the chastisement of the fire.
17. The patient, and the truthful, and the obedient, and those who
spend (benevolently) and those who ask forgiveness in the morning times.
18. Allah bears witness that there is no god but He, and (so do) the
angels and those possessed of knowledge, maintaining His creation with
justice; there is no god but He, the Mighty, the Wise.
19. Surely the (true) religion with Allah is Islam, and those to whom
the Book had been given did not show opposition but after knowledge had
come to them, out of envy among themselves; and whoever disbelieves in
the communications of Allah then surely Allah is quick in reckoning.
20. But if they dispute with you, say: I have submitted myself entirely
to Allah and (so) every one who follows me; and say to those who have been
given the Book and the unlearned people: Do you submit yourselves? So if
they submit then indeed they follow the right way; and if they turn back,
then upon you is only the delivery of the message and Allah sees the servants.
21. Surely (as for) those who disbelieve in the communications of Allah
and slay the prophets unjustly and slay those among men who enjoin justice,
announce to them a painful chastisement.
22. Those are they whose works shall become null in this world as well
as the hereafter, and they shall have no helpers.
23. Have you not considered those (Jews) who are given a portion of
the Book? They are invited to the Book of Allah that it might decide between
them, then a part of them turn back and they withdraw.
24. This is because they say: The fire shall not touch us but for a
few days; and what they have forged deceives them in the matter of their
religion.
25. Then how will it be when We shall gather them together on a day
about which there is no doubt, and every soul shall be fully paid what
it has earned, and they shall not be dealt with unjustly?
26. Say: O Allah, Master of the Kingdom! Thou givest the kingdom to
whomsoever Thou pleasest and takest away the kingdom from whomsoever Thou
pleasest, and Thou exaltest whom Thou pleasest and abasest whom Thou pleasest
in Thine hand is the good; surety, Thou hast power over all things.
27. Thou makest the night to pass into the day and Thou makest the
day to pass into the night, and Thou bringest forth the living from the
dead and Thou bringest forth the dead from the living, and Thou givest
sustenance to whom Thou pleasest without measure.
28. Let not the believers take the unbelievers for friends rather than
believers; and whoever does this, he shall have nothing of (the guardianship
of) Allah, but you should guard yourselves against them, guarding carefully;
and Allah makes you cautious of (retribution from) Himself; and to Allah
is the eventual coming.
